Why it is not possible to access the Word document contents page by page in .NET WebForms ?

1 min read

The Word document is a flow document in which contents will not be preserved page by page; instead the contents will be preserved sequentially section by section. Each section may extend to various pages based on its contents like table, text, images etcWord viewer/editor renders the contents of the Word document page by page dynamically when opened for viewing or editing and these page wise rendered information will not be preserved in the document level as per Word file format specification. Whereas Essential DocIO is a non UI component that provides a full-fledged document object model to manipulate the Word document contents.

Hence it is not directly possible to access the Word document contents page by page, the same holds in Essential DocIO. As workaround you can split the contents of each page as separate section in the Word document and access the contents by sections instead of pages.
